- The distance between Florania, Brazil and Sal, Cape Verde is approximately 2,964 km or 1,842 mi.
- To reach Florania in this distance one would set out from Sal bearing 212.1°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Florania bearing 210.8° or SSW .
- Florania has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Sal has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The average annual temperature is 2.1 °C (3.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.4 °C (4.3°F) less in Florania.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 658.8 mm (25.9 in) more which is equivalent to 658.8 l/m² (16.17 US gal/ft²) or 6,588,000 l/ha (704,301 US gal/ac) more. About 10 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.9° higher in Florania than in Sal.
- Relative humidity levels are 9.7%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.4°C (0.7°F) lower.
